> It's the JobPrio attribute, and it is scoped to a single user (or
> accounting group) on a single Schedd. I can set my job's JobPrio as
> high as I like, but I won't be able to jump you in line unless my (as
> a user) priority is higher.
>
> If you want to have one user's jobs run before another's, you should
> adjust the relative userprio.
Interesting! I use:
Priority = 98
in my classads and I'd swear that these are globally honored, so
*anyone* with the highest current "Priority" on their job will have
theirs execute first.
